About Revilla Jr/Sr High School

Revilla Jr/Sr High School is one of the micro-enrollment four-year high schools in Ketchikan, Alaska, operated by Ketchikan Gateway Borough School District, with 110 students on its rolls from grades 7 through 12. Compared to the state average of about 373 students per school, that is 71% smaller than typical.

Ketchikan Gateway Borough School District runs 9 schools in total, collectively educating 2,043 students. Revilla Jr/Sr High School is one of those campuses.

For racial and ethnic makeup, Revilla Jr/Sr High School logs that the largest single group is White at 53%, but no single group is in the majority. The remainder looks like 35% Native American, 6% multiracial, 3% Asian. That is meaningfully less White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 63%.

On the income-and-resources front, Staff filings list 11 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 10.5:1 students per teacher.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 17.0:1 average. Around 53%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, often used as a Title I proxy. That share is higher than Ketchikan Gateway Borough's rate of about 38%.

In the surrounding community, community-level numbers for Ketchikan Gateway Borough indicate median household income runs about $92,885, 27%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 5%. In all, Ketchikan Gateway Borough runs 9 public schools (combined enrollment of about 2,043 students), of which Revilla Jr/Sr High School is one.

Nearest neighbor: Houghtaling Elementary, around 0.0 miles off. Counting just inside five miles, 6 other public schools cluster around Revilla Jr/Sr High School.

Geographically, the school is in a town-based area.

Looking at the recent track record. Revilla Jr/Sr High School's enrollment has increased 5% since 2018, when it stood at 105 (now 110). White enrollment moved from 40% to 53% across the same window. The student-to-teacher ratio narrowed from 13.1:1 in 2018 to 10.5:1 today.
